Have You Considered Your Digital Assets in Your Estate Plan?

by | Sep 6, 2018 | Business Formation, Digital Assets, Estate Planning, Trusts, Wills

What digital assets you say? We don’t always consider that we have such things but most of us do. Your email account, for example. Do you get invoices via email? How will your Agent under a Power of Attorney even know about a bill that has to be paid if that Agent cannot access your email. What about online banking? Facebook account? Do you have an iTunes library? We all should have a password manager (an app that keeps all of your passwords) or a hard copy in a little notebook accessible by your Agent. The password to the app or the location of the notebook needs to be kept in a secure place which complicates things a little but if become incapacitated or you die, someone will need to be able to access those accounts.
